Tips for Choosing the Perfect Pet Costume

When selecting a costume for your furry friend, there are a few things to keep in mind:

  • Comfort: Ensure that the costume is comfortable for your pet to wear. Avoid costumes that restrict movement or cover their eyes, nose, or mouth.
  • Safety: Choose a costume made from non-toxic materials and avoid any parts or accessories that could be easily chewed off and swallowed.
  • Size: Take accurate measurements of your pet before purchasing a costume to ensure the perfect fit. Avoid costumes that are too tight or too loose.

Tips for Introducing Your Pet to Their Costume

While some pets may be comfortable wearing costumes right away, others may need some time to adjust. Here are a few tips to help introduce your pet to their Halloween attire:

  • Start Early: Don't wait until the last minute to put the costume on your pet. Begin introducing it gradually a few weeks before Halloween, allowing them time to get used to it.
  • Reward System: Use treats and positive reinforcement to create a positive association with wearing the costume. Reward your pet with treats or praise when they tolerate or wear the costume.
  • Short Practice Sessions: Initially, only have your pet wear the costume for short periods of time. Gradually increase the duration as they become more comfortable.
